Output ebd76e12c6b33ead04e37b29a7181add47c36ac91f87121f9b9bb7541a492063:0

value
375214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1c02cf28a145a3bee62fed82d7abce2d3505b4 OP_EQUAL
address
3P8AGrrqonyt8wYRPF6kQQc13xwxcJivTs
transaction
ebd76e12c6b33ead04e37b29a7181add47c36ac91f87121f9b9bb7541a492063
spent
true